Embodiment 1

[0033] The raw material oil is extracted oil refined by minus fourth-line solvent, and its properties are shown in Table 1. The dewaxing aid is paraffin wax with a melting point of 62° C., and the paraffin oil content is 1.2%, and the mass ratio of the dewaxing aid to the raw oil is 0.12: 1; the dewaxing solvent is a butanone-toluene mixed solvent, and the volume content of butanone is 50%; the multi-point dilution process is adopted, and the total agent-oil ratio is 2.0:1. Prepare dewaxed oil by the flow process of accompanying drawing 1, and concrete process is as follows:

[0034] Add the dewaxing aid to the raw oil, heat to 75°C, fully melt and mix evenly, then add each dilution solvent in turn. Cool to -10°C, filter to obtain dewaxed filtrate and dewaxed wax paste, dewaxed oil is obtained from the filtrate after solvent removal, and oily wax is obtained from the wax paste after solvent removal. The dewaxing results are shown in Table 2.

Embodiment 2

[0038] The raw material oil is the minus third-line distillate oil, and its properties are shown in Table 1. The dewaxing aid is paraffin wax with a melting point of 56° C., the wax oil content is 2.0%, and the mass ratio of the dewaxing aid to the raw oil is 0.07: 1; the dewaxing solvent is a butanone-toluene mixed solvent, and the volume content of butanone is 75%, the multi-point dilution process is adopted, and the total agent-oil ratio is 3.5:1. Prepare dewaxed oil by the flow process of accompanying drawing 1, and concrete process is as follows:

[0039] Add the dewaxing aid to the raw oil, heat to 80°C, fully melt and mix evenly, then add each dilution solvent in turn. Cool to -20°C, filter to obtain dewaxed filtrate and dewaxed wax paste, dewaxed oil is obtained from the filtrate after solvent removal, and oily wax is obtained from the wax paste after solvent removal. The dewaxing results are shown in Table 2.

Embodiment 3

[0043]The raw material oil is furfural refined oil of light deasphalted oil, and its properties are shown in Table 1. The dewaxing aid is paraffin wax with a melting point of 68° C., the wax oil content is 0.5%, and the mass ratio of the dewaxing aid to the raw oil is 0.02: 1; the dewaxing solvent is a butanone-toluene mixed solvent, and the volume content of butanone is 65%, the multi-point dilution process is adopted, and the total agent-oil ratio is 5.5:1. Prepare dewaxed oil by the flow process of accompanying drawing 1, and concrete process is as follows:

[0044] Add the dewaxing aid to the raw oil, heat to 90°C, fully melt and mix well, then add each dilution solvent in turn. Cool to -15°C, filter to obtain dewaxing filtrate and dewaxed wax paste, obtain dewaxed oil after removing solvent from filtrate, and obtain oily wax after removing solvent from wax paste. The dewaxing results are shown in Table 2.

Abstract

The invention relates to a solvent dewaxing method for low waxy hydrocarbon oil. The method includes: mixing raw oil, dewaxing auxiliaries and dewaxing solvent, cooling the mixture to a filtering temperature, filtering to obtain filtrate and cerate, and removing the solvent from the filtrate to obtain dewaxed oil, wherein C17-C100 n-alkane mass content in the dewaxing auxiliaries is larger than or equal to 40%, and the mass ratio of the dewaxing auxiliaries to the raw oil ranges from 0.01:1 to 0.30:1. Using the solvent dewaxing method can more effectively dewaxing the low waxy hydrocarbon oil to lower dewaxing temperature difference and increase filtering speed.

Description

technical field [0001] The invention belongs to a method for dewaxing hydrocarbon oil. In particular, the present invention relates to a process for solvent dewaxing of low waxy hydrocarbon oils. Background technique [0002] In order to maintain the low-temperature fluidity of the lubricating oil, the wax contained in the raw oil must be removed during the production of the lubricating base oil to lower the freezing point or pour point of the lubricating base oil. Industrially, wax products after wax deoiling are divided into paraffin wax and microcrystalline wax. Paraffin wax is mainly composed of normal paraffins and a certain amount of isoparaffins, while microcrystalline waxes contain normal paraffins, isoparaffins and alkyl cycloalkanes. , and contains a certain amount of alkyl aromatic hydrocarbons.
